Matt began working conventions with San Diego Comic-Con (SDCC) in 2015 with the Studio Relations Team. Shortly after he was invited to work WonderCon and solidified his position as Dock Coordinator where studios and Talent started looking for him specifically. Matt helped create the Bayfront Squad, a team dedicated to facilitating movements in and around the Bayfront hotel for SDCC, while continuing to maintain his dock coordination position. Realizing a love of conventions, Matt soon reached out and began working more conventions and quickly assumed the role of Guest Services Director due to his ease of working with Talent. He became known in the field due to his professional demeanor, iconic flat cap, and style of dress, which in turn became his signature look. Matt maintains professionalism with every aspect he brings to a convention, and extends that same professionalism to his team. For these reasons, Matt is highly sought after and now travels world-wide, working 25+ conventions per year.
